Job Description
Position Summary:
The Supervisor - Food may work in any type of food location on client premises. This individual provides oversight at the direction of management on site to coordinate routine work activities of workers and/or service employees engaged in food operations or services at either larger complex facilities or locations in the areas of commercial, health care, schools, universities, or other establishments. This individual will provide support to management in the daily oversight of key functions and employees during the normal course of business. The general responsibilities of the position include those listed below, but Sodexo may identify other responsibilities of the position. These responsibilities may differ among accounts, depending on business necessities and client requirements.

General Responsibilities:
  • Reports all accidents and injuries in a timely manner.
  • Responsible for the oversight of day-to-day activities of subordinates and assigns responsibility for specific work or functional activities as directed by on-site management.
  • Assists in ensuring a safe working environment throughout the facility for all employees.
  • Assists in monitoring employee productivity and provides suggestions for increased service or productivity.
  • Participates in regular safety meetings, safety training and hazard assessments.
  • Understands and follows all policies and procedures.
  • Performs day-to-day assignments in addition to oversight duties.
  • Responsible for orientation and training of employees.
  • Attends training programs (classroom and virtual) as designated.
  • Complies with all Sodexo HACCP policies and procedures.
  • Promote in the development of the food service team.
  • Complies with all company safety and risk management policies and procedures.
  • Works with customers to ensure satisfaction in such areas as quality, service, and problem resolution.
  • May per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
  • Attends all allergy and foodborne illness in-service training.

Physical Requirements:
  • Ability to work in a standing position for long periods of time (up to 8 hours).
  • Significant walking or other means of mobility.
  • Close vision, distance vision, peripheral vision, depth perception and the ability to adjust focus, with or without corrective lenses.
  • Ability to reach, bend, stoop, push and/or pull, and frequently lift 35 pounds and occasionally lift/move 40 pounds.
Working Conditions (may add additional conditions specific to defined work location):
  • The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ate to loud.
  • While performing the duties of this job, the employee is primarily in a controlled, temperate environment; however, may be exposed to heat/cold during support of outside activities.
  • Generally in an indoor setting, however, may supervise outside activities and events.
  • Varying schedule to include evenings, holidays, weekends, and extended hours as business dictates.
